## Deployment

Bulk edits in the Marrowgate admin table ship behind a flag. Enable it per-tenant, never globally, until the Kestwick pilot closes. Bulk operations lock the affected rows; batches over 500 rows are rejected server-side. Deploy order: API first, then admin UI, then enable the flag. Rollback is flag-off only — do not revert the API, as the audit schema migration is one-way. Release manager confirms each step in the deploy channel. Ship with the configuration below.

config for tagep-yajef:
ulawyn:
  log_level: error
  metrics_host: metrics.ulawyn.lumiclabs.internal
  pin: 0564
  pool_size: 32

# Welcome to the Tumblebin locker access module!
# Quick primer: a resident taps their fob, we mint a short-lived
# unlock token, and the locker controller burns it on first use.
# Tokens expire fast on purpose — lost fobs shouldn't open doors
# an hour later. If the controller is offline we queue the grant
# and retry, but only briefly. Don't change these casually; the
# hardware team tuned them against real latch timing. The values
# we settled on are listed below.

tuning constants:
QUOTAS = {
    "druwyn": 5,
    "holix": 5,
    "zorath": 5,
    "holwyn": 10,
}

MEMO — Veltrane Systems, Receiving, Dorsey Point site

Six Quillax M4 demo units are being returned from the Harwick trade floor. All were powered down and factory-reset by the field team; do not re-image before intake inspection. Log serial plates against the loan sheet and flag any missing styli. Cartons are marked DEMO RETURN in orange. Expected arrival Thursday morning via courier. Storage bay 3 is reserved. The confidential hand-over instruction for the courier follows below.

courier memo of kagug-yajof: the belys wenok courier leaves the praix ledger at gate 8902 under passcode 669584